Transaction 022019421dc313fca92805193dc7e07f80b4826753505d1e2f393faef9803a35

7 Input
2 Outputs
  • 022019421dc313fca92805193dc7e07f80b4826753505d1e2f393faef9803a35:0
  • value  5311427
    address  1FbdnVFJAwhV4xWet7CUTDCBbt4buMcE2D
  • 022019421dc313fca92805193dc7e07f80b4826753505d1e2f393faef9803a35:1
  • value  22698478
    address  bc1qsx89f3rr34dc4umxzugayjp7evj4r8e407vjra